Bridesmaids’ Tea Chicken Salad
Excerpt From: Gooseberry Patch - Potluck Favorites
This elegant chicken salad is perfect for a special ladies’ luncheon or tea. Serve on crisp, chilled salad greens for a lovely presentation.
1-1/2 c. mayonnaise
3/4 c. chutney, chopped if chunky
2 t. lime zest
1/4 c. lime juice
1 t. curry powder
1/2 t. salt
4 c. boneless, skinless chicken breast, cooked and diced
3 8-oz. cans pineapple chunks, drained
2 c. celery with leaves, sliced on the diagonal
1 c. green onion tops and bottoms, thinly sliced
1/2 c. toasted sliced almonds
Garnish: salad greens
In a large bowl, combine mayonnaise, chutney, lime zest and juice, curry powder and salt. Mix well. Gently fold in remaining ingredients except garnish. Cover and chill at least 4 to 6 hours; may be made the night before. Stir again before serving, being sure to stir all the way to the bottom. Serve on salad greens. Makes 8 to 10 servings.
